Iroha Karuta is a game consisting of pairs of cards--a picture card and a reading card. Players match the picture with the text. This set was produced by a children's magazine as a New Years "furoku" or gift with the January 1952 issue. It is sometimes called the "wallpaper back" set because of the unusual back design. Since the set depicts players in their 1951 uniforms and was released in December of 1951, it technically could be construed as a 1951 set, which would then make the Wally Yonamine card a rookie. While single cards and small groups of cards have occasionally been seen, this marks the first time that we have seen a complete set in the original box.

Fifteen Hall of Famers are represented in the lot-Wally Yonamine (Hawaii), Masaichi Kaneda (400 lifetime wins), Tetsuharu Kawakami (God of Batting), Hiroshi Oshita (bad boy of Japan Pro Baseball), Shigeru Chiba, Makoto Kozuru, Tokuji Iida, Kazuto Tsuruoka, Katsumi Shiraishi, Kaoru Betto, Yoshiyuki Iwamoto, Atsushi Aramaki, Takehiko Bessho, Shigeru Sugishita and Fumio Fujimura. One HOFer missing-Nishizawa.

38 player cards and 40 reading cards.

Size: Each card is approximately 2" x 3"

Condition: The general player card condition is Vg to Ex, except that there is a tiny number written in ink at upper left. Reading cards are Ex/Mt to Nm.
